The 2005 Impala was the last of its generation, and therefore saw few changes. Among these changes was that OnStar was now a standard feature on all trims, a popular enhancement among Impala drivers.
Engines remained the same: a 3.4-liter, 180 horsepower V6 for the standard sedan, a 3.8-liter, 200-horsepower V6 for the LS, and a 3.8-liter, 240horsepower V6 for the SS.
Drivers love the solid handling, rapid acceleration, and all-over peppy drive. Some have complained that the car does not approach is estimated 21 city/32 highway mileage (20/30 and 18/28 for the LS and SS), yet many seemed pleased with the efficient gas mileage accompanying the strong engine.
All trims now come standard with driver, passenger, and side airbags, creating a safe environment for the up to six passengers inside the car.
